Highlights:
It is the original Rapid Prototyping technique, and still the most commonly used.
It is comparatively low-cost.
It utilizes a light-sensitive liquid polymer.
It requires post-curing since laser is not intense enough to fully cure.
Extended curing can cause warping.
Parts are somewhat brittle and have a tacky surface.
There is no milling process, so dimensional accuracy can suffer.
Support structures are typically required.
The process is simple: Neither milling nor masking steps are required.
Uncured material should be expected to emit toxic fumes. Thorough ventilation is necessary.
Applications:
When a low number of prototypes is needed (1-10).
Form and fit testing.
Plastic piece rapid-tooling patterns.
Metal piece rapid-tooling patterns.
Focus group and presentation models.
Small parts with complicated structures prototyping ,like toys
